What kinds of help exist locally
In Oakley, survivors can find a range of assistance tailored to their specific needs, including:
- Legal Aid: Many organizations offer legal services for divorce, custody, and protective orders without charge or at a reduced fee.
- Pro Bono Services: Some lawyers volunteer their time to provide legal assistance to survivors of domestic violence.
- Counseling and Therapy: Mental health professionals can help you process your experiences and develop coping strategies.
- Hotlines: Confidential hotlines provide immediate support and guidance, connecting you with resources and professionals.
- Shelters: Safe shelters offer temporary housing and support services for those fleeing abusive situations.
How to choose between hotline, shelter, lawyer, therapist, and legal aid
Choosing the right type of support can be overwhelming. Here are some tips to help you decide:
- Assess Your Immediate Needs: If you are in danger, prioritize your safety by contacting a hotline or seeking shelter.
- Consider Legal Assistance: If you need help navigating the legal system, reaching out to a legal aid organization may be beneficial.
- Seek Emotional Support: Therapists can provide a safe space for you to discuss your feelings and experiences.
- Use Hotlines for Guidance: Hotlines can help you understand your options and connect you to the right resources.
Safety and privacy when seeking help
Your safety and privacy are paramount when seeking assistance. Here are some steps you can take to protect yourself:
- Use Secure Communication: If possible, use a private phone or computer to contact resources. Clear your browsing history to maintain privacy.
- Be Cautious with Information: Only share personal information with trusted professionals or organizations.
- Trust Your Instincts: If something feels off, prioritize your safety and seek help from a different source.
What to expect when you reach out
When you contact a legal service, hotline, or support organization, you can expect:
- Confidentiality: Most organizations prioritize your privacy and will keep your information secure.
- Empathy and Support: Trained professionals are there to listen to your concerns and offer assistance without judgment.
- Guidance on Next Steps: You will receive information on available resources and your options moving forward.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. How can I find a legal aid organization in Oakley?
Search online for local legal aid services or contact a domestic violence hotline for referrals.
2. Are there any costs associated with legal aid?
Many legal aid services are free or low-cost, but it’s best to confirm any potential fees when you reach out.
3. What should I take with me if I go to a shelter?
Bring essential items such as identification, medication, clothing, and any important documents.
4. Can hotlines provide legal advice?
Hotlines can offer guidance and connect you to legal resources, but they do not provide legal advice.
5. How can I ensure my safety when contacting these resources?
Use a secure phone or computer, and only share personal information with trusted professionals.
